About the role:
As a Bank Cover Worker, you will be working for a people-led organisation whose mission and values are to inspire change across Sussex.
The Archway Project is a 24-hour residential service comprising of two houses in Hove.
Porland Road is a 9 bed CQC registered residential project for clients with mental health support needs. Clients reside at Portland Road for up to 2 years.
Step-Down is a 5 bed CQC registered project which supports the move of individuals from inpatient services back to the community. Residents are supported with activities of daily living and any social or practical needs for up to a 16 week stay.
Both services have a recovery and person-centred focus, working collaboratively with residents in intensive short-term placements. The aim is to enable people to move on to more independent living within two years.
Bank Cover Workers provide invaluable, relief cover when permanent members of the team are absent. Bank Cover Workers will develop professional relationships with clients based on trust, which will enable effective and empathic emotional support. Bank Cover Workers will provide practical support in a range of areas with an emphasis on clients developing life skills and confidence to live independently. They will ensure the day-to-day running of the service is carried out efficiently and effectively. This will involve dispensing medication, supporting clients to develop and build on their existing daily living skills, towards more independence.
Key Responsibilities:
- Provide emotional and practical support to clients in line with the function and process of service, and respond to urgent support and high-risk situations, as appropriate.
- Supporting clients in developing life skills including self-care, shopping, cooking tenancy management
- Assisting in efficient domestic running of the houses
- Ensuring that records are kept up-to-date and accurate, and an efficient filing system is maintained including the use of appropriate information technology.
- To provide cover to a rota which will include day and late shifts; sleeping night shifts; Weekend work
Person Specification:
To be successful in the role of Bank Cover Worker you will need to have great communication skills and be committed to the values of the organisation. Some of the key skills and experience you will need to bring with you include:
- An understanding of mental health and related issues, including impact on day-to-day life and recovery
- Professional boundaries; safeguarding, accountability, and confidentiality within the workplace.
- Competent use of Microsoft software packages especially Word, Excel and Outlook
- Excellent interpersonal skills on both individual and group levels
- Ability to work proactively and effectively both independently and as a team member
